All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Dalewood Avenue area has the 8th lowest crime rate of 29 local areas in Hawes Side , and the 212th lowest crime rate of 494 local areas in Blackpool .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Dalewood Avenue (FY4 4BT) in the last 12 months was 94.6 per 1,000 residents and was 7.3% lower than the Hawes Side average (102.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 9 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 8 (β 36.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 60.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-55.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Dalewood Avenue (FY4 4BT), the main crime hotspot is near Euxton Court. Police recorded 36 crimes here, including 22 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
